description | There is described a polymeric material comprising at least one repeat unit, the or each (if more than one) repeat unit consisting substantially of a moiety of Formula (1) in which: Y1 represents, independently if in different repeat units, N, P, S, As and/or Se, preferabl y is N; Ar1 and Ar2 which may be the same or different, represent, independent ly if in different repeat units, a multivalent (preferably bivalent) aromatic group (preferably mononuclear but optionally polynuclear) optionally substituted by at least one optionally substituted C1-40carbyl-derived groups and/or at least one other optional substituent, a nd Ar3 represents, independently if in different repeat units, a mono or multivalent (preferably bivalent) aromatic group (preferably mononuclear but optionally polynuclear) optionally substituted by at least one: optionally substituted C1-40carbyl-derived group and/or at lea st one other optional substituent; where at least one terminal group is attached in the polymer to the Ar1, Ar2 and optionally Ar3 groups located at the end of the polymer chains, so as to cap the polymer chains and prevent further polymer growth, and at least one terminal group is derived from at least one end capping reagent used in the polymerisation to form said polymeric material to control the molecul ar weight thereof. A charge transport material comprising such polymers is of use in (amongst other things) electroreprographic device s and electroluminescent devices. A method of making these polymers by controlling their molecular weight with an end capping reagent i s also described. |
